Here's the average price of a home in Fairview and Marino in 2017

The latest data from Daft.ie.

THE AVERAGE ASKING price of a home in Fairview and Marino is now just a shade over €433,000, according to the newest figures.

Analysis by Daft.ie shows that the average list price across all properties in the area was €433,050 in the third quarter of 2017.

This is a fair bit above the overall average of €395,000 across Dublin city and county. Prices in Fairview and Marino have also risen faster than the norm – up by 81% in the last five years, from a low point of €239,300 in 2012.

They remain significantly lower than their Celtic Tiger peak. Prices hit €576,000 in 2006.

The data suggests that buyers will pay a premium to live in Fairview and Marino, compared to some neighbouring areas. Drumcondra’s average price is €415,484, with Beaumont’s at €327,566. In East Wall and North Strand it is €279,225.

However, prices in Clontarf on the seafront are significantly more expensive with the average at €533,654.
